1. La Fortuna Waterfall

First up is the famous La Fortuna Waterfall, which is practically a right of passage for visitors.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Height: About 70 meters (230 feet).
  • Accessibility: A short hike (about 500 steps down, but who’s counting?) to get there.
  • Tip: Bring water shoes if you plan to swim—you’re gonna want to take a dip!

2. Rio Celeste Waterfall

The water here is not just blue; it’s vibrant, like a bottle of blue raspberry candy exploded. Here’s the scoop:

Feature Details
Location: TENORIO VOLCANO NATIONAL PARK
Why It’s Special: The blue color comes from a chemical reaction between sulfur and calcium carbonate.
Best Time to Visit: During the dry season (December to April) for optimal photo ops.

Fun fact: Some travelers swear the water tastes like blueberry slushies. Just kidding—don’t drink it!

3. Nauyaca Waterfalls

Located in the Southern Pacific region, Nauyaca is a two-tiered beauty that looks like something straight out of a movie. Here’s how to enjoy it:

  • Getting There: You’ll need to hike about 4 kilometers, but the views are worth every step.
  • Perfect Timing: Go early in the morning to avoid the crowds—it’s great for that scenic selfie with no photobombers.

Essential Tips for Visiting Costa Rica

Before you pack your bags and jump on a plane to Costa Rica, here are some nifty little tidbits that might make your adventure smoother than a sloth on a Sunday. You might even want to jot these down in your travel journal (yes, the one you swear you’ll use but end up doodling in instead).

Tip Details
Currency Colón (CRC) – Don’t worry, it’s not named after Christopher! 1 USD ≈ 600 CRC.
Time Zone CST (GMT-6) – No need to set your watch; they don’t do Daylight Saving Time here.
Climate Tropical – two seasons: wet and dry. You’ll either be soaked or sun-kissed.
Transport Renting a car is handy ️, but don’t forget the roads are an adventure in themselves!
Safety Tip Stay aware of your surroundings. Pura Vida doesn’t mean «pura descuido»!
Language Spanish – Learning «¡Pura Vida!» is like picking up the local handshake.
Tipping Usually around 10-15% of the bill. Your waiter will appreciate you more than your last date!
